Already Pre-Approved? Let Us Take a Second Look at Your Mortgage Options

Jun 18, 2026

If you’ve already received a pre-approval from another lender, you might feel like the hard part is done. But taking a moment for a second look could uncover better rates, lower monthly payments, or a loan program that fits your life in Central Indiana even more closely. Many homebuyers in Indianapolis, Fishers, Carmel, Noblesville, and Westfield discover meaningful savings and smoother experiences simply by exploring their options one more time.

A second opinion doesn’t mean starting over. It means making sure the financing you’re carrying into your home purchase truly works in your favor.

Common Questions Buyers Ask When Considering a Second Look

Many people wonder whether requesting another pre-approval will hurt their credit. A soft inquiry for pre-approval purposes typically has minimal impact, and we can discuss timing so it aligns with your overall plans.

Others ask if it’s too late once they’re under contract. In most cases, we can still review your options and potentially improve terms before closing, especially if your current pre-approval is nearing expiration.

Some buyers are concerned about the time involved. The review process is straightforward—we gather your existing documents, ask a few questions about your goals, and provide a clear comparison within a short timeframe.
